The Bestida Pier is located in the town of Bestida, in the municipality of Murtosa, in an area in close proximity to the tranquil waters of the Ria de Aveiro. Its position offers a privileged perspective over the water mirror, allowing one to spot Torreira, situated on the opposite bank, and establishing an interesting visual connection with this area.
For decades, before the construction of the Varela Bridge in 1964, Bestida Pier was an essential crossing point. From here, boats regularly departed, transporting people and goods between Bestida and Torreira. This pier played a vital role, functioning as a true aquatic "highway" connecting the two banks of the Lagoon, shaping the life and commerce of the region.
Currently, Bestida Pier maintains its relevance for the local fishing community. The site serves as a safe harbor, providing a secure refuge for fishermen's boats, and continues to be a space for activity and interaction with the lagoon. Its most recent construction, in 1999, reinforces the continuous importance of this point for the people of the Lagoon.
Integrated into a natural route, Bestida Pier is a place that invites landscape contemplation. The surroundings are marked by the beauty of the Ria de Aveiro, with its channels and the unique salt marsh ecosystem. It is an excellent spot for those who appreciate observing the avifauna that inhabits this lagoon, offering moments of serenity in contact with the vibrant nature of the region.
